What is Elevare Community?
Elevare Community is a dedicated nonprofit organization that focuses on improving the lives of adults with special needs, specifically those diagnosed with autism and other intellectual and developmental disabilities. Through their efforts in housing development, regulatory management, and residential program placement, they strive to create a nurturing, supportive, and empowering environment where these individuals can flourish. Elevare Community also takes it upon themselves to educate families and service providers about quality housing options for adults with special needs. Furthermore, they extend their mission to raise autism awareness through the creation of informative online content. Their work seeks to provide a path to prosperity and an enriching life for these individuals.

Is Elevare Community legitimate?
Elevare Community is a legitimate nonprofit organization registered as a 501(c)(3) entity. Elevare Community submitted a form 990EZ, which is a tax form used by tax-exempt organizations in the U.S., indicating its operational transparency and adherence to regulatory requirements. Donations to this organization are tax deductible.

What is the revenue of Elevare Community?
Elevare Community's revenue in 2022 was $71,278.
